2026 Hyundai Sonata vs 2026 Nissan Altima

Shoppers comparing the 2026 Hyundai Sonata vs 2026 Nissan Altima are looking for a sedan that balances sleek style, confident performance, and meaningful technology that makes every mile easier. Hyundai leans into that formula with available HTRAC All Wheel Drive, a thrilling N Line performance trim, a sophisticated dual 12.3-inch panoramic curved display, and a Sonata Hybrid with e-Dynamic Drive. Nissan counters with available Intelligent All-Wheel Drive, ProPILOT Assist, and a newly available 12.3-inch touchscreen. The difference shows up in everyday convenience and depth of features: Sonata offers available Remote Smart Parking Assist, Bluelink+ connected services, Hyundai Digital Key 2 Premium, and an available Surround View Monitor, all designed to simplify driving and parking around town. Feature 2026 Hyundai Sonata 2026 Nissan Altima
Available All-Wheel Drive Yes Yes
290-hp performance trim Yes No
Hybrid model available Yes No
Dual 12.3-inch panoramic curved display (touchscreen + digital cluster) Yes No
Wireless Apple CarPlay® and Android Auto™ Yes Yes
Connected services app with remote start (Bluelink+ / NissanConnect®) Yes Yes
Highway-driving lane-centering assist (HDA / ProPILOT Assist) Yes Yes
Remote Smart Parking Assist Yes No
Blind-Spot View Monitor camera feed in cluster Yes No
360-degree camera system Yes Yes

Powertrain – Hyundai Dealership in Schaumburg, IL

Hyundai builds the Sonata to cover a wide range of needs. The standout is Sonata N Line, with a 2.5-liter turbo engine producing 290 horsepower and 311 lb.-ft. of torque, paired to an N 8-speed Wet Dual Clutch Transmission with paddle shifters—the hardware that makes acceleration satisfyingly immediate. Drivers who want a calmer character can choose the responsive 2.5-liter 4-cylinder paired with available HTRAC All Wheel Drive for added traction. Sonata Hybrid layers in a smooth gas-electric system tuned for refined power delivery and impressive range, enhanced by e-Dynamic Drive for confident handling. Across the lineup, the powertrains feel polished and engineered for real-world flexibility, whether scooting across town or settling into an effortless highway cruise. Altima streamlines choices with a 2.5-liter 4-cylinder delivering up to 188 horsepower on select trims. It’s responsive and efficient, and with available Intelligent All-Wheel Drive, it has reassuring capability for variable weather. The difference is choice and headroom—Sonata lets you go hybrid for efficiency-focused commuting or N Line for high-output thrills. That powertrain versatility is a decisive advantage when comparing the 2026 Hyundai Sonata vs 2026 Nissan Altima on performance breadth alone.

Safety – Hyundai Sonata vs Nissan Altima

Hyundai SmartSense equips every Sonata with a comprehensive suite that includes Forward Collision-Avoidance Assist with Pedestrian, Cyclist, and Junction Turning Detection, Lane Keeping Assist, Lane Following Assist, Driver Attention Warning, Smart Cruise Control with Stop & Go, High Beam Assist, and Rear Cross-Traffic Collision-Avoidance Assist. Available Highway Driving Assist helps with lane centering and distance-keeping on compatible highways, while available Blind-Spot View Monitor projects a live camera feed to the cluster to enhance lane-change confidence. On select trims, features like Surround View Monitor and Parking Collision-Avoidance Assist – Reverse bring extra assurance in crowded lots. Remote Smart Parking Assist—standard on Sonata Hybrid Limited—can even move the car into or out of tight spaces with the Smart Key. Altima makes Nissan Safety Shield 360 standard across the board, adds available ProPILOT Assist for lane-centering highway driving, and offers Intelligent Around View Monitor for a composite 360-degree view when parking. Intelligent Forward Collision Warning is also a helpful standard feature. Both sedans take safety seriously; Sonata’s unique touches—especially Blind-Spot View Monitor and Remote Smart Parking Assist—tip the scales for drivers who want an edge in dense traffic and snug street parking.
